Corrupted Shapeshifter

3U · Creature — Eldrazi Shapeshifter

Devoid (This card has no color.) As Corrupted Shapeshifter enters the battlefield, it becomes your choice of a 3/3 creature with flying, a 2/5 creature with vigilance, or a 0/12 creature with defender. */*
